想要获取Webbrowser Mouse Hover的坐标,当Document为null时单击

时间:2015-01-28 07:37:36

标签: c# winforms .net-4.0 webbrowser-control

我想在子类中的Webbrowser控件中添加一个功能,这样当我在webbrowser控件上鼠标(点击,悬停,鼠标等)时,它会像所有其他控件一样引发一个事件。

我可以在Webbrowser Control中找到OnMouseClickEvent,因为它是从System.Windows.Form.Control继承的,但它不起作用,也不能在object中使用。

如何添加此功能并使用该事件,一旦我有权访问此功能,我可以使用Pinvoke获取坐标。

我在谷歌搜索但没有找到相关的帮助,我试图自己做,但由于理解不多,我无法进一步。请帮助我获得此功能。

1 个答案:

答案 0 :(得分:0)

如果您想使用JS,可以使用这些指南。这个js和功能描述可以帮助你很多 https://developer.mozilla.org/en-US/docs/Web/API/MouseEvent

如果您在鼠标事件发生时未使用任何服务器端事件,这将是满足您需求的最佳解决方案。

相关问题